Raja & Nati F.M “Bishvil Hanefesh”
In a time when it is not always easy to understand what is happening around us, the need to believe, know, and internalize that there is a hand that directs everything arises.
“Misovev Hasibot” is the second single from the joint album of Shlomo Raja and Nati F.M – “Bishvil Hanefesh“.
After the single “Bayit” opened the project, “Misovev Hasibot” comes, which brings with it additional musical color to the project with a melodic Afro-beat rhythm. It is a song that connects music, reality, faith and the reality of faith.
This is a song about the ability to stop, observe, and say thank you – both for what is clear to us, and for what is not yet.
From the knowledge that not everything is in our hands, but everything happens in providence, privately.
